树莓派上安装Clash代理软件完整教程

目录

  1. 前言
  2. 准备工作
  3. 安装Clash 3.1. 下载Clash安装包 3.2. 安装Clash 3.3. 配置Clash
  4. Clash使用教程 4.1. 启动Clash 4.2. 配置代理规则 4.3. 更新订阅节点
  5. 常见问题解答 5.1. Clash无法启动 5.2. 代理连接断开 5.3. 订阅节点更新失败

前言

树莓派作为一款功能强大且性价比高的单板电脑,广受开发者和用户的喜爱。在树莓派上安装并使用Clash代理软件,可以轻松实现科学上网,访问被限制的网站和服务。本文将为大家详细介绍如何在树莓派上安装和配置Clash,并解答使用过程中的常见问题。

准备工作

在安装Clash之前,需要先进行以下准备工作:

  • 准备一台树莓派设备,并确保系统已更新至最新版本。
  • 确保树莓派能够连接互联网,并能够访问常见的软件下载网站。
  • 准备一个可用的Clash订阅链接或者节点信息。

安装Clash

下载Clash安装包

  1. 访问Clash官方GitHub仓库,下载适用于ARM架构的Clash安装包:

    https://github.com/Dreamacro/clash/releases

  2. 选择最新版本的Clash安装包,并下载到树莓派上。

安装Clash

  1. 使用以下命令解压Clash安装包:

    tar -xzf clash-linux-armv7.gz

  2. 将解压出的文件移动到系统的bin目录下:

    sudo mv clash /usr/local/bin/

  3. 给Clash可执行文件添加权限:

    sudo chmod +x /usr/local/bin/clash

配置Clash

  1. 创建Clash的配置文件目录:

    sudo mkdir /etc/clash

  2. 在配置文件目录中创建config.yaml文件,并添加以下内容: yaml port: 7890 socks-port: 7891 redir-port: 7892 allow-lan: true mode: rule log-level: info external-controller: 0.0.0.0:9090 external-ui: /usr/local/share/clash

  3. 将你的Clash订阅链接或者节点信息添加到config.yaml文件中的proxiesproxy-groups部分。

Clash使用教程

启动Clash

  1. 使用以下命令启动Clash:

    sudo clash -d /etc/clash

  2. 打开浏览器,访问http://localhost:9090即可进入Clash的Web控制台。

配置代理规则

  1. 在Clash的Web控制台中,切换到Profiles选项卡。
  2. 选择合适的代理模式,如Rule模式或Global模式。
  3. 根据需要调整代理规则,如国内网站直连,国外网站走代理等。

更新订阅节点

  1. 在Clash的Web控制台中,切换到Proxies选项卡。
  2. 点击Update按钮,更新订阅节点信息。
  3. 选择合适的节点进行连接。

常见问题解答

Clash无法启动

  1. 检查Clash可执行文件的权限是否正确。
  2. 确保配置文件config.yaml格式正确无误。
  3. 尝试以root用户身份运行Clash。

代理连接断开

  1. 检查网络连接是否正常。
  2. 尝试切换其他节点进行连接。
  3. 检查Clash的日志信息,查找可能的原因。

订阅节点更新失败

  1. 检查订阅链接是否正确。
  2. 确保网络环境能够访问订阅链接。
  3. 尝试手动更新节点信息。

希望本文对你在树莓派上安装和使用Clash有所帮助。如果你还有其他问题,欢迎在下方留言。

正文完